The study is a prospective randomized controlled trail to compare early urinary continence recovery after robotic-assisted radical prostatectomy with or without sustainable functional urethral reconstruction (SFUR).

Early urinary incontinence has always been a tricky problem for both patients and urologists, even though over 90% patients can recover 1 year after surgery. Many urologists are trying to modify the surgical technique to resolve this problem. Sustainable functional urethral reconstruction (SFUR) is a novel technique which may improve early urinary continence recovery for both local and locally advanced prostate cancer, and even for those with high volume prostate by providing adequate urethral length with bladder neck tubularization and making sustainable periurethral support with peritoneal flap. The purpose of this study is to verify the impact of this new technique on early recovery of urinary continence, as well as on urinary function and oncological outcomes.
